Output d304ce8daa9fcd1587c672eb4c5c5760efe60c90e087c0588904dcc9322b339f:1

value
20550279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491ef9adaa16996c144933694728263e2be0e76c OP_EQUAL
address
38MeMkRA6do5i8seF2ycU9hG7U7xfZCpts
transaction
d304ce8daa9fcd1587c672eb4c5c5760efe60c90e087c0588904dcc9322b339f
confirmations
270525
spent
true